Covert Lethality kills any non-boss enemy when you do a Finisher attack on them, regardless of their alert status. This means that doing a Finisher on an unalerted enemy, triggering a counterstrike or using an ability that opens them to Finisher attacks would trigger it (Radial Blind, Sleep Arrow, Teleport). There are enemies that are inmune to finishers, like Ospreys and Juggernaut though.

Mod is worded wrong. It triggers on finishers (not ground finishers), alert state does not matter. Any skill that opens up the enemy to finishers will do. + regular stealth finisher killing ofc.

Next to that with inaros the enemies are only blinded when they are facing you at the time of casting. Pocket sanding them in the back will not trigger this effect thus will not open them to finishers.

And you need the finisher prompt to finish someone.

The mod's wording could use a revamp. The "Lethality" only applies to Stealth Finishers, and also Counter Finishers since they are counted as the same thing for some arcane reason, but NOT Ground Finishers (again for some arcane reason), so don't think spamming slam attacks will help any.

However, triggering a Stealth Finisher is tricky. In a normal mission, unless the enemy is under the effect of a Blind, Sleep, or Stun, you absolutely cannot have any alarm active or have made any noise or allowed yourself to be spotted, because that will put the enemy on various degrees of Alert. Active alarms actually put the entire level on maximum Alert, so to get the most out of CL, you need to deal with raised alarms immediately. If you're in an endless mode like Survival or Defense, or a level with a fire hazard, then enemies start off in full alert and so Blind, Sleep, and Stun become the only way to get enemies into a finisher state even if you're invisible.

Also, there are no side animations for finishers, so make sure to be as close to directly behind (or in front of if you're relying on a B/S/S) your target as possible, and wait for the prompt.
